Convergence results for a phase transition model with vanishing microscopic acceleration

Articolo
Data di Pubblicazione:
2004
Abstract:
A recent phase transition model, proposed by Fremond, is based on the consideration
that the microscopic movements are responsible for the phase transition at the macro-
scopic level. A last version of the model, accounting also for the microscopic accelerations
has been investigated in Ref. 4, where well-posedness results are established for related
Cauchy{Neumann problems. The aim of this paper is the study of the asymptotic be-
havior of the solution to one of the above problems, as the power of the microscopic
acceleration forces goes to zero.
